VSA light comes on during cold starts??

does anyone know what can cause my VSA light to come on during cold starts?? here in Winnipeg, Manitoba it gets cold overnight typically dropping down to -30 degrees celcius or -22 degrees fahrenheit. It doesn't happen all the time, but occasionally the light will come on and I'll get the message about my VSA system being off, and then after driving for a while and the engine warms up, the light will go off and the message will disappear after an engine restart. Any ideas?

2010 Acura TL FWD with 140km or 87k miles.
